Lysenkoism was a pseudoscientific movement in the Soviet Union, led by Trofim Lysenko, that rejected Mendelian genetics in favor of Lamarckian ideas, claiming acquired traits are heritable. Supported by the Communist Party and Stalin, it promoted the belief that environmental influences could directly and rapidly change organisms, leading to disastrous agricultural policies, purges of geneticists, and a major setback for Soviet biology.
